Understanding Peptides, SARMs, and Nootropics

Peptides are essential for various biological functions, playing roles in immune response, hormone regulation, and cellular communication. On the other hand, SARMs are designed to selectively target androgen receptors, promoting muscle growth while minimizing side effects associated with traditional anabolic steroids. Nootropics, meanwhile, enhance cognitive functions, making them popular among researchers exploring brain health and performance. Understanding these compounds is crucial for effectively leveraging them in research.

Legal and Ethical Considerations

Researchers must navigate a complex legal landscape when working with research compounds. In many jurisdictions, peptides and SARMs may not be approved for human use, posing regulatory challenges. It is vital to stay informed about local laws and ethical guidelines governing the use of these substances to avoid legal repercussions.

Navigating Research and Regulatory Hurdles

Research involving peptides and SARMs often requires navigating regulatory frameworks that can be cumbersome. Researchers should familiarize themselves with institutional review boards (IRBs) and obtain the necessary approvals before commencing studies. By ensuring compliance with regulatory standards, scientists can conduct their research responsibly and ethically.
